dubbogo 注册中心和配置中心 我是在linux下使用dubbo-2.3.3以上版本的zookeeper注册中心客户端。Zookeeper是Apache Hadoop的子项目,强度相对较好,建议生产环境使用该注册中心。Dubbo未对Zookeeper服务器端做任何侵入修改,只需安装原生的Zookeeper服务器即可,所有注册中心逻辑适配都在调用Zookeeper客户端时完成。 Zooleeper安装 ...
一、介绍Apollo(阿波罗)是携程框架部研发并开源的一款生产级的配置中心产品,它能够集中管理应用在不同环境、不同集群的配置,配置修改后能够实时推送到应用端,并且具备规范的权限、流程治理等特性,适用于微服务配置管理场景。Apollo目前在国内开发者社区比较热,在Github上有超过5k颗星,在国内众多互联网公司有落地案例,可以...
nacos : Alibaba 开源的配置管理组件,提供了一组简单易用的特性集,帮助您实现动态服务发现、服务配置管理、服务及流量管理。 而考虑到某些公司内部有自身的研发的配置中心,又或者当前流行而 dubbo 尚未支持的配置中心,如 etcd,我们的核心在于设计一套机制,允许我们——也包括用户——可以通过扩展接口新的实现,来快速...
由于dubbo-go 框架依赖配置文件启动,让框架定位到配置文件的方式就是通过环境变量来找。对于 server 端需要两个必须配置的环境变量:CONF_PROVIDER_FILE_PATH、APP_LOG_CONF_FILE,分别应该指向服务端配置文件、日志配置文件。 在sample 里面,我们可以使用 dev 环境,即 profiles/dev/log.yml 和 profiles/dev/server.ym...
配置中心在 Dubbo-go 3.0 中,可以将上述框架配置或用户配置放置在配置中心内便于管理。在容器内只需要放置配置中心相关信息即可基于该配置启动框架。 dubbo:config-center: # 配置中心信息protocol: nacosaddress: 127.0.0.1:8848data-id: dubbo-go-samples-configcenter-nacos-server 配置API开发者可以在代码内...
dubbo-go 这边考虑到跟 Dubbo2.6 和 2.7 的互通性,同样支持 url 和配置文件方式的服务配置,同时兼容应用级别和服务级别的配置,跟 dubbo 保持一致,目前已经实现了zookeeper和apollo作为配置中心的支持。 dubbo-go roadmap 2019-2020 最后是大家比较关注的,社区关于 dubbo-go 2019 年下半年的计划,目前来看主要还是...
自带链接池的。此回答整理自钉群“dubbogo社区1”
在 Dubbo-go 中调用 Spring Cloud 的 Dubbo 接口,需要注意以下几点:配置相应的 Dubbo 协议和 Spring ...
消费者配置文件: dubbo: consumer: references: UserProvider: url: tri://localhost:20000 protocol: tri serialization: json interface: com.apache.dubbogo.samples.rpc.extension.UserProvider tls_config: ca-cert-file: x509/server_ca_cert.pem tls-cert-file: x509/client2_cert.pem tls-key-file: x509...